mada tops the 2019 YouGov Brand Advocacy Rankings in Saudi Arabia

The Saudi payment network is the most recommended brand among consumers in the Kingdom

mada has topped the list of Saudi’s most recommended brands and has moved up six places from last year to become number one in the 2019 rankings.

Emaar which topped the list last year has fallen down one spot to second and Emirates has fallen down two places to fourth this year.

But the greatest decline year on year has been witnessed by iPhone and its parent brand Apple. While iPhone declined from third in 2017, to fourth in 2018 and now seventh in 2019, Apple fell from second to sixth in 2018, and now places ninth in the 2019 rankings.

The Saudi Arabia Advocacy Rankings, produced by YouGov’s daily brand tracking tool BrandIndex, considered how much current and former customers endorsed brands over the past year by asking respondents, "Would you recommend the brand to a friend or colleague?" or “Would you tell a friend or colleague to avoid the brand?”.

Almarai seems to be winning back consumers after the price rise debacle last year and has moved up one place in the rankings to eighth this year.

Majid Al Futtaim, Sentosa Island (Singapore) and IMG Worlds of Adventure (Dubai) are new entrants in the top 10 list of 2019- at fifth, sixth and tenth, respectively.

YouGov also revealed the brands that have the most improved level of customer advocacy in Saudi over the past 12 months. Mobily has seen the greatest improvement of 10.5 points in its Recommend score this year, increasing from 23.6 last year to 34.2 this year.

Mentos and Snapchat are the second and third best improvers of 2019, with a change in score of 9.5 and 9.4, respectively.

Bin Laden Group (change in score of 9.1), Mazda (8.9), Huawei (8.7), Finish (8.3), Saudi Telecom (7.7), Coca- Cola (7.7) and Pepsi (7.7) are the other brands that complete the list of top 10 improvers of 2019.

Methodology

YouGov BrandIndex screened all of its 499 brands in Saudi Arabia for their net Recommend score, which asks respondents "Would you recommend the brand to a friend or colleague?" and “Would you tell a friend or colleague to avoid the brand?” Only respondents who are current or former customers of a given brand are considered. Rankings data was collected between November 1, 2018 and October 31, 2019 and Improvers data was collected between November 1, 2017 and October 31, 2019. All brands must have a minimum N of 200 and have been tracked for at least 6 months to be included in the rankings and at least 6 months in the prior year's period (as well as being currently tracked) to be included among improvers.
